电脑用户

计算机爱好者和高级用户的问答

9
如何通过SSH密钥使用Mac OS X钥匙串?
我了解自Mac OS X Leopard以来,钥匙串支持存储SSH密钥。有人可以解释一下此功能的工作原理。 我有一些生成的RSA密钥存储在我的〜/ .ssh目录中,用于访问各种服务器。我没有在这些键上设置密码短语。当前,为了登录到这些服务器,我在终端中使用以下命令: 评估`ssh-agent` ssh-add〜/ .ssh / some_key_rsa SSH用户@服务器 (我已经编写了一些Bash函数来简化此过程。) 有没有更好的方法可以使用钥匙串做到这一点?
140 macos  ssh  keychain 

6
tmux调色板如何工作?
我正在尝试将某些内容设置为灰色,但无法弄清楚该怎么做。手册页中关于颜色的唯一信息是: message-bg colour Set status line message background colour, where colour is one of: black, red, green, yellow, blue, magenta, cyan, white, colour0 to colour255 from the 256-colour palette, or default. 我还找到了一篇博客文章,该文章遍历颜色,但是我不太理解它,也不想整天坐在终端上猜测颜色数字,直到一个可行为止。
140 tmux 


8
在OS X 10.6 Snow Leopard中,$ PATH在哪里设置?
我echo $PATH在命令行上键入并获取 /opt/local/bin:/opt/local/sbin:/Users/andrew/bin:/usr/local/bin:/usr/local/mysql/bin:/usr/local/pear/bin:/usr/bin:/bin:/usr/sbin:/sbin:/usr/local/bin:/usr/X11/bin:/opt/local/bin:/usr/local/git/bin 我想知道这是在哪里设置的,因为我的.bash_login文件为空。 我特别担心的是,在安装MacPorts之后,它在中安装了一堆垃圾/opt。我认为该目录甚至不存在于正常的Mac OS X安装中。 更新:感谢jtimberman更正我的echo $PATH陈述


23
以完全隐藏的方式运行批处理文件
我正在寻找某种方式来运行批处理文件(.bat),而用户看不到任何东西(没有窗口,没有任务栏名称,等等)。 我不想使用某些程序来执行此操作,我正在寻找更清洁的工具。我已经找到了使用VBScript 的解决方案,但我也不太喜欢使用VBS。

4
如何使用cURL显示POST数据?
例如,使用-v参数发布到Web服务器: curl -v http://testserver.com/post -d "firstname=john&lastname=doe" 和输出 > POST /post HTTP/1.1 > User-Agent: curl/7.19.7 (universal-apple-darwin10.0) libcurl/7.19.7 OpenSSL/0.9.8l zlib/1.2.3 > Host: testserver.com > Accept: */* > Content-Length: 28 > Content-Type: application/x-www-form-urlencoded > < HTTP/1.1 200 OK (etc) 没有提及我发布的数据。 cURL中是否有一个选项可在输出中显示字符串“ firstname = john&lastname = doe”? 注意:显然我想要的字符串在我执行的命令中,但是还有其他几个发布选项,例如--form和--data-ascii等。我希望看到原始数据正在发送到服务器。
139 curl  debug 


13
如何使Windows VPN路由选择性流量(通过目标网络)?
我想使用Windows VPN,但仅限于特定网络,因此它不会占用我的整个网络连接。 例如,不要将VPN变为默认路由,而是将其设置为192.168.123.0/24的路由 (我可以看到Ubuntu 在这个问题上有一个解决方案,但有时我也必须在Windows上这样做) 这可以自动化,这样每当我连接到VPN时它会这样做吗?

8
为什么在可移动媒体上通过NTFS使用exFAT?
因此,基本上,我始终默认将可移动大容量存储设备格式化为NTFS,但是有人告诉我,最好使用exFAT。现在,我一直在四处寻找Google,但是找不到我应该这么做的任何充分理由。 exFAT有什么作用(更好),而NTFS在(> 4GB)可移动海量存储中使用时有用吗?


3
为什么在\ Users \ <用户名> \ AppData下有名为Local,LocalLow和Roaming的目录?
我有一个运行Windows Server 2008并已登录到AD域的工作站,并且我具有Ubuntu Linux的双重启动功能。在运行Linux时,我希望能够使用Windows下使用的相同Thunderbird配置文件,因此我指出Thunderbird使用在以下位置找到的配置文件: \Users\(myname)\AppData\Local\Thunderbird\Profiles 事实证明这不是正确的配置文件-配置正确,但是收件箱是旧版本。我最终发现正确的路径是: \Users\(myname)\AppData\Roaming\Thunderbird\Profiles 在这些不同的地方存储应用程序数据的背后的原理是什么?

21
当“ nslookup”工作正常时,为什么“ ping”无法解析名称?
在Windows XP工作站上,我可以使用nslookup以下命令在DNS中找到要连接的计算机: nslookup wolfman Server: dns.company.com Address: 192.168.1.38 Name: wolfman.company.com Address: 192.168.1.178 但是,当我尝试连接到该计算机时,出现一个错误,告诉我找不到该计算机(即,无法在DNS中查找该计算机): C:\&gt; ping wolfman Ping request could not find host wolfman. Please check the name and try again. 如果我直接使用IP地址,则可以连接: C:\&gt; ping 192.168.1.178 Pinging 192.168.1.178 with 32 bytes of data: Reply from 192.168.1.178: bytes=32 time=41ms TTL=126 Reply from 192.168.1.178: …
138 windows  networking  dns 



By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.